    A question for anyone who might know.

    Is there a difference in framesize and/or grip form between Cattleman?

    We tried the Cattleman Gunfigter and the Cattleman OM Charcoal Blue yesterday and the Cattleman seemed to be a tighter fit bewtween the pistol grip and the trigger guard. My wife's knuckle rubbed on the trigger guard on the Gunfighter but not the OM where there was plenty of space. My thinking is that it had to do with the type of grip but wanted to see if anyone of this forum had any ideas

    I think grip-form is different.

    Looking closely at the images available on Uberti's site, it does look as if the Gunfighter has a thicker, more edge-rounded-off grip.

    My Cattleman NM has a more swept-back grip; thicker at the back and narrower at the front (kinda like an egg shape, sorta).

    It's hard to tell with pictures though.

    I tried a pearl handled one at a store and it wasn't for me. Nothing wrong with it, it just didn't feel right in my hand.
